Resumo:
This work sought to investigate the most common fertilization practices in the cultivation of açaí in terra firme areas, in the municipality of Moju, in the lower Tocantins region of the state of Pará/Brazil. Açaí is an important fruit for the local and national economy and has been gaining ground in international trade, this is due to the fact that açaí is a fruit rich in proteins, fibers, lipids and some vitamins, it is also a good antioxidant, has good, amount of phosphorus, iron and calcium. The methodology used was based on a case study via a questionnaire to collect data from growers in the region, discussing the most common ways of growing the fruit and the fertilizers used, as well as the frequency with which the fertilizers are applied to the planting of açaí, in addition to issues related to sustainability, cultivated land, improvements after using fertilizers and irrigation systems. In this way, satisfactory results were found regarding the cultivation of açaí in the areas of terra firme, since the fertilizers used are (NPK and limestone chemical fertilizers, complemented with organic fertilizer animal manure, açaí seeds and leaves, palm loofah ) These fertilizers are applied two to three times a year or more depending on soil conditions.
